Subject: Sampling logs from Chirpbox before it buries us

Hey Loomworks folks,

Chirpbox is emitting roughly 40k log lines a minute and our ingest bill is getting silly. We're flipping on 10% sampling at the relay starting Thursday — error-level lines are always kept, so don't panic. If you need full-fidelity logs for a debug window, call the relay's override endpoint with the temporary bearer token pasted below.

session JWT of yawep-yawep = eyJhbGciOiJIUzI1NiIsInR5cCI6IkpXVCJ9.eyJzdWIiOiI3pWF3_In0.aXYsHiog

Subject: Legacy pricing — heads up

Team, we're moving ahead with the 8% increase for legacy Ferrowave customers from April. Grandfathered accounts on the old Tideline plans get 90 days' notice instead of 60 — Priya's call, and I agree. Expect some churn noise in the Bellmoor segment; support scripts are being updated. Please keep this tight until notices go out. The underlying rationale is set out below.

internal memo for hahaf-kahof: Only 39 of the 428 pilot accounts renewed Sorion, so a churn review is set for April 12. Praokix Freight is in early talks to buy Queniusox Group for about $145.8 million.

## Service accounts — Migrator

The Shiftlane migrator runs dual-write phases under a dedicated service account; never reuse app accounts. Reviewers: confirm expand/contract ordering and that backfills are idempotent before approving. The account authenticates to the internal schema registry per job. For local verification runs, use the staging key below.

API key for yahig-tadup: kto7_ubizbYm

TICKET #— Roof-terrace door, Halloway Court, Level 6. Door jams mid-swing; closer arm suspected. Contractors attending: use the east stairwell, not the lift, as the lobby is being retiled. Terrace is closed to staff until repair is signed off. Tools may be left in the Level 6 store overnight. Report to the duty engineer on arrival and again before leaving site. The stairwell door requires the contractor access code, which follows below.

door code, kawip-bagap: bdg-HQEWH-4